The Foundry Bridge, Norwich painting by Robert Ladbrooke is a stunning example of English landscape art. Created in 1833, this oil on canvas piece measures 67 x 98 cm and showcases the artist's skill in capturing the serene atmosphere of a town surrounded by trees. The scene features a man walking across the bridge, while another person can be seen standing nearby, adding a sense of life and movement to the painting.

The Artist and His Style
Robert Ladbrooke was an English landscape painter who, along with John Crome, founded the Norwich School of painters. His style is characterized by his ability to depict the natural beauty of rural England.
